首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

迭代子图

是指在图论中,通过迭代算法生成的子图。迭代子图可以通过不断迭代的方式,从一个初始节点开始,逐步扩展出更多的节点和边,形成一个逐步增长的子图。

迭代子图的分类可以根据不同的迭代算法和生成规则进行划分。常见的迭代子图包括深度优先搜索(DFS)生成的子图、广度优先搜索(BFS)生成的子图、随机游走生成的子图等。

迭代子图的优势在于可以通过有限的初始节点,逐步扩展出更多的节点和边,从而探索和发现图中的隐藏信息和关联关系。迭代子图可以用于社交网络分析、推荐系统、信息传播模型等领域。

在腾讯云中,推荐使用图数据库 Tencent Cloud Neptune 来存储和查询迭代子图。Tencent Cloud Neptune 是一种高性能、高可靠性的图数据库服务,支持海量节点和边的存储和查询,适用于复杂的图数据分析和图算法计算。您可以通过以下链接了解更多关于 Tencent Cloud Neptune 的信息:Tencent Cloud Neptune

希望以上信息能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

代子模式

代子模式的意图及组成 迭代子模式有两种实现方式,分别是白箱聚集与外禀迭代子和黑箱聚集于内禀迭代子。...由于聚集自己实现迭代逻辑,并向外部提供适当的接口,使得迭代子可以从外部控制聚集元素的迭代过程。这样一来迭代子所控制的仅仅是一个游标而已,这种迭代子叫做游标迭代子(Cursor Iterator)。...由于迭代子是在聚集结构之外的,因此这样的迭代子又叫做外禀迭代子(Extrinsic Iterator)。...迭代子模式组成 迭代子模式的组成主要有以下几个角色: 抽象迭代子(Iterator)角色:此抽象角色定义出遍历元素所需的接口。...由于迭代子是聚集的内部类,迭代子可以自由访问聚集的元素,所以迭代子可以自行实现迭代功能并控制对聚集元素的迭代逻辑。

79560

设计模式-迭代子模式

针对这样的问题,在客户端和集合对象之间增加一个迭代子这么一个中间层,使得客户端和集合对象之间由直接变成间接,降低耦合力度。 迭代子模式的类大概如下所示 ?...Aggregate集合:创建迭代子的接口; ConcreteAggregate 具体集合:实现迭代子接口; Iterator 迭代子接口:给出迭代每个元素的接口; ConcreteIterator 具体迭代子...,作用相当于一个游标,有个雅称叫游标迭代子;改良的做法是集合对象对外不提供对元素的修改方法,只对迭代子提供宽接口。...迭代子模式的意义是使得客户端与迭代子任务分开,使二者各自完成自己的主要工作,在集合对象发生改变或者迭代方法发生变化的时候,有了这个迭代子缓冲地带,我们可以尽量只对迭代子部分进行修改。...迭代子把集合的循环迭代方法进行了处理,集合本身不需要迭代;集合本身可以包含不仅一个的迭代子,根据情况获取不同的迭代子,进行不同的迭代子处理;遍历算法包括迭代子内部,因此迭代子独立于集合。

41930
  • 代子模式

    代子模式的意图及组成 迭代子模式有两种实现方式,分别是白箱聚集与外禀迭代子和黑箱聚集于内禀迭代子。...由于聚集自己实现迭代逻辑,并向外部提供适当的接口,使得迭代子可以从外部控制聚集元素的迭代过程。这样一来迭代子所控制的仅仅是一个游标而已,这种迭代子叫做游标迭代子(Cursor Iterator)。...由于迭代子是在聚集结构之外的,因此这样的迭代子又叫做外禀迭代子(Extrinsic Iterator)。...迭代子模式组成 迭代子模式的组成主要有以下几个角色: 抽象迭代子(Iterator)角色:此抽象角色定义出遍历元素所需的接口。...由于迭代子是聚集的内部类,迭代子可以自由访问聚集的元素,所以迭代子可以自行实现迭代功能并控制对聚集元素的迭代逻辑。

    72570

    Java设计模式(十六)----迭代子模式

    代子模式 一、 概述 二、 结构 1.白箱聚集与外禀迭代子 2.黑箱聚集与内禀迭代子 主动迭代子和被动迭代子...二、结构 迭代子模式有两种实现方式,分别是白箱聚集与外禀(bǐng)迭代子和黑箱聚集与内禀迭代子。...由于迭代子是在聚集结构之外的,因此这样的迭代子又叫做外禀迭代子(Extrinsic Iterator)。...在得到迭代子的实例后,客户端开始迭代过程,打印出所有的聚集元素。 主动迭代子和被动迭代子   主动迭代子和被动迭代子又称作外部迭代子和内部迭代子。   ...●动态迭代子则与静态迭代子完全相反,在迭代子被产生之后,迭代子保持着对聚集元素的引用,因此,任何对原聚集内容的修改都会在迭代子对象上反映出来。

    693100

    多相机视觉系统的坐标系统标定与统一及其应用

    案例分析: (3)检测流程 先分别利用每张的两条垂直边计算出它们的交点,那么得到的4个交点就可以算出L1和L2的值,如下图所示(以右下角相机为例)。 ?...调整摄像机焦距、灯光以及交区域,使用一个大的可以覆盖整个视野的参照物。为了保证可以将多幅图像拼接为一副大,它们之间必须存在一个小的交区域。...将单个图像拼接为一个大: 首先,每幅图像都必须进行校正,将这些图像转换到一个共有的坐标系中,它们之间就会正确匹配。...在得到所有进行校正图像需要的映射后,使用两个摄像机拍摄的每个图像对都可以进行校正并且高效的拼接。拼接的结果由两幅校正后的图像组成,每个校正后的图像占图像的一个部分,下图为校正后的图像和拼接结果。...如果在某些交区域内的特征不明显那么可以通过定义合适的图像对来克服。如果整个物体的特征都不是特别明显,那么交区域就应该更大一些。 (3) 交的图像的缩放比例必须大约相等。

    7.3K20

    Max-DeepLab全景分割流水线,分辨率高达51.3%

    全景分割会预测一组不重叠的蒙版及其对应的类别标签,例如,物体的类别:“汽车”,“交通信号灯”,“道路”等,通常会使用多个替代子任务来完成该任务。...例如,Axial-DeepLab(无目标框的方法) 可以预测到实例的逐像素偏移,但是替代子任务会遇到高度变形的挑战,这些对象具有多种形状,例如,下面这张坐在椅子上的狗,它的形状较为复杂。 ?...终于成功 如下图所示,MaX-DeepLab正确地分割了坐在椅子上的狗,左边第一张。 Axial-DeepLab的方法发现对象中心偏移,因此做了回归来替代子任务。...不过第二张失败了,因为狗和椅子的中心太此靠近。 DetectoRS的方法用对象的边界框来替代子任务。由于椅子边界框的置信度低,因此它会过滤掉椅子面罩,所以也失败了。

    97750

    美国知名科创中心的创业活动主要集聚在这些街区

    软件 第一张显示了软件行业的投资情况,该行业吸引了120亿美元的投资,占全美风险投资总额的36%。...Winston-Salem,圣戈,杜伦-教堂山,亚特兰大,纽约,圣罗莎和克利夫兰各有一个地区进入前20。...总的来看,风险投资金额最多的地区中,旧金山有9个,圣琼斯有5个,波士顿-剑桥有3个,圣戈,达拉斯,纽约各有一个。...很多地区都位于城市中心或者毗邻知名大学如MIT,斯坦福,加州大学,圣戈大学和纽约大学。...斯坦福大学所在地,帕罗奥吸引了9.88亿美元的风险投资,列第三位。还有3个地区吸引的风险投资超过了5亿美元,2个在旧金山,1个在圣戈。

    2.8K80

    Modern C++,学炸了!!

    本文思维导 一、方法论 作为写了十多年 C++ 的过来人,我想说的是,会写 C++ 是一回事,写好 C++ 则是另外一回事。...__begin 需要支持自增操作,且每次循环时会与 end-expr 返回的迭代子 __end 做判不等比较,在循环内部,通过调用迭代子的解引用(*)操作取得实际的元素。...但是上面的公式中,在一个逗号表达式中 auto __begin = begin-expr, __end = end-expr; 由于只使用了一个类型符号 auto 导致起始迭代子 __begin 和结束迭代子...__end 是同一个类型,这样不太灵活,在某些设计中,可能希望结束迭代子是另外一种类型。...__begin 和结束迭代子 __end 分开来写,这样这两个迭代子就可以是不同的类型了。

    3.1K10
    领券